Background

Stichting Wageningen Research (SWR) is an international NGO registered in Ethiopia since March 2021 with the FDRE Agency for Civil Society Organizations. The organization is established with the objectives of promoting a more resilient, inclusive and sustainable food systems in Ethiopia. One of the projects implemented by SWR is Ethiopia-Netherlands Seed Partnership (ENSP).

The Ethiopia-Netherlands Seed Partnership (ENSP)

You will implement planned activities that increase selected seed businesses’ access to finance and further strengthen their capacities for seed business management with the intended outcome of doubling their production, both in terms of value and diversity of products in their portfolio. You will do this in support of the Partnership’s overall mission to enable the private sector in Ethiopia to deliver farming men and women high quality seed of improved varieties much needed for food security and nutrition, and climate resilience. The Partnership is development cooperation between Ethiopia and the Netherlands, implemented by a consortium of the Ethiopian Seed Association in Ethiopia, and Plantum and Wageningen University & Research in the Netherlands.
